site stats

Sql join records not in second table

WebYou were very close with this version however a little trick with outer joins is that if you add a filter to the outer table in the WHERE clause, you turn an outer join to an inner join, … WebAug 20, 2024 · Right Anti Join: Records Only in the Second Table The same Approach can be used for rows that exist only in the second table, using the Right Anti Join But right Anti Join will give you a result which looks a bit weird if you do not expand the table;

Mysql: Select rows from a table that are not in another

WebIf the joins are not there, create them by dragging each related field from the first table (the table that has unmatched records) to the second table (the table that has related records). Double-click a join to open the Join Properties dialog box. For each join, choose option 2, and then click OK. WebPress CTRL+V to paste the SQL code that you copied in step 3. In the code that you pasted, change LEFT JOIN to RIGHT JOIN. Delete the semicolon at the end of the second FROM clause, and then press ENTER. Add a WHERE clause that specifies that the value of the join field is NULL in the first table listed in the FROM clause (the left table). rollingdale winery https://themarketinghaus.com

Db2 for i SQL: Joining data from more than one table - IBM

WebJan 24, 2012 · Here is the solution: ( select col1 from table1 t1 EXCEPT Select col1 from table2 t2 ) UNION ( select col1 from table2 t2 EXCEPT Select col1 from table1 t1 ) There are other techniques too to solve the above problem. Do post comments and let the readers know about your solution. WebA left exception join returns only the rows from the first table that do not have a match in the second table. Cross join A cross join, also known as a Cartesian Product join, returns a result table where each row from the first table is combined with each row from the second table. Full outer join WebMar 22, 2024 · There are many great tutorials on syntax, performance, and keywords for invoking subqueries. However, I wish to discover a tip highlighting selected SQL subquery use cases. Please briefly describe three SQL subquery use case examples. For each use case, cover how a subquery interacts with outer queries and the T-SQL for implementing … rollinger electric

SQL CROSS JOIN to get Every Combination of Records

Category:How to Return non matching records from two tables

Tags:Sql join records not in second table

Sql join records not in second table

How to Join Tables in SQL Without Using JOINs LearnSQL.com

WebJul 15, 2024 · SQL Join statement is used to combine data or rows from two or more tables based on a common field between them. Different types of Joins are as follows: INNER JOIN LEFT JOIN RIGHT JOIN FULL JOIN Consider the two tables below: Student StudentCourse The simplest Join is INNER JOIN. A. INNER JOIN WebSep 20, 2007 · But if the second table #b is a mix of more JOINS this will not perform that fast. It seems that LEFT JOIN and NOT EXISTS are both superior to NOT IN. Which one of the two approaches you choose, must be decided carefully for …

Sql join records not in second table

Did you know?

WebApr 12, 2024 · Here, the WHERE clause is used to filter out a select list containing the ‘FirstName’, ‘LastName’, ‘Phone’, and ‘CompanyName’ columns from the rows that contain the value ‘Sharp ... WebSQL query to select record with ID not in another table 1.SQL QUERY Using LEFT JOIN SELECT t1.Id, t1.name FROM Users t1 LEFT JOIN UserEducation t2 ON t2.UserId = t1.Id WHERE t2.UserId IS NULL Generic Query SELECT TABLE1.Id, TABLE1.Name, FROM TABLE1 LEFT JOIN TABLE2 ON TABLE1.Id = TABLE2.Id WHERE TABLE2.Id IS NULL

WebYou were very close with this version however a little trick with outer joins is that if you add a filter to the outer table in the WHERE clause, you turn an outer join to an inner join, because it will exclude any rows that are NULL on that side (because it doesn't know if NULL would match the filter or not). WebFeb 6, 2024 · You can you use an intelligent left join to return non-matching rows only from left table (Service) SELECT S.Id, S.Name FROM [Service] S LEFT JOIN ServiceAsset SA ON S.Id = SA.ServiceId WHERE SA.ServiceId IS NULL Note: INNER JOIN returns the matching …

WebDec 9, 2024 · This article will show you two additional methods for joining tables. Neither of them requires the JOIN keyword to work. They are: Using a comma between the table …

WebSep 15, 2009 · The same holds for NOT EXISTS. Since it's a predicate, not a JOIN condition, the rows from t_left can only be returned at most once too. EXISTS always returns TRUE or FALSE and it will return TRUE as soon as it finds only a single matching row in t_right, or FALSE, if it find none.

WebJul 20, 2024 · sql joins. Learn how to use JOIN to keep both matched and unmatched rows when you join two tables. Joining two or more tables is a skill you need a lot if you’re … rollingcrest splash poolWebNov 26, 2024 · SQL: Find Items in Table A Not in Table B Goal: Find records from Table A (Students) that do not exist in Table B (Rooms) Prerequisites: 2 Tables with relational data, Ability to run SQL Queries There is often times you wish to find items in one table or query that are not in another table or query. rollingdale winery kelownaWebApr 5, 2013 · How to JOIN two table to get missing rows in the second table. CREATE TABLE elections ( election_id int (11) NOT NULL AUTO_INCREMENT, title varchar (255), CREATE … rollinger tree collectionWebSep 16, 2024 · The join is done by the JOIN operator. In the FROM clause, the name of the first table ( product) is followed by a JOIN keyword then by the name of the second table ( … rollinger toitureWebApr 9, 2024 · In the INNER JOIN clause, we specify the second table to join (also referred to as the right table). Then, we use the ON keyword to tell the database which columns should be used for matching the records (i.e., the author_id column from the books table and the id column from the authors table). rollingexileWebApr 12, 2024 · Here, the WHERE clause is used to filter out a select list containing the ‘FirstName’, ‘LastName’, ‘Phone’, and ‘CompanyName’ columns from the rows that contain … rollinger cremoneWebApr 25, 2016 · The query takes 45 minutes to run on a decent server, about 20% of cost is in the hash joins. – ODBC Apr 30, 2016 at 4:33 Add a comment 1 Answer Sorted by: 1 SELECT tbl_A.id FROM tbl_A LEFT JOIN tbl_B ON tbl_A.id = tbl_B.id WHERE tbl_B.id IS NULL This is most likely how I would do something like that. rollingfcu